Haslingden is a town in the Rossendale Valley, Lancashire, known for its industrial heritage and scenic surroundings. The area features a mix of residential neighborhoods, local businesses, and green spaces like Haslingden Grane, a popular spot for walking and cycling. The town center has a range of shops, cafes, and services, catering to everyday needs.
Haslingden is surrounded by moorland and hills, offering views of the Pennines. The town has historical landmarks such as the Haslingden War Memorial and the former mills that reflect its textile industry past. Transport links include bus routes and proximity to the M66, providing access to Manchester and other nearby towns. The community hosts events and markets, adding to its local character.
